Description

Jewelry stone grabbing processing device
Technical Field
The utility model relates to the technical field of jewelry processing, in particular to a jewelry stone grabbing processing device.
Background
Along with the development of society and the improvement of living standard of people, people have higher and higher requirements on living goods and jewelry, more and more ornaments appear in people's life simultaneously, people pursue the diversification and the exquisite degree of jewelry more and more, demand for the jewelry inlaid with jewelry increases more and more, current bracelet class machining tool sets up to thick claw usually, in the course of working, inefficiency, and very easy damage jewelry and the jack catch of fixed jewelry, lead to the product defective rate high, therefore, the prior art has the defect, needs to improve.

As shown in fig. 1-2, the jewelry stone-grasping processing device of the embodiment includes an installation base 1, a jewelry fixing jig 2, a positioning component 3 and a stone-grasping component 4, the jewelry fixing jig 2 and the stone-grasping component 4 are respectively installed on the installation base 1, the stone-grasping component 4 is provided with a stone-grasping module 41 and an adjusting limiting component 42 for limiting the moving distance of the stone-grasping module 41, the stone-grasping module 41 is located above the jewelry fixing jig 2, one end of the positioning component 42 is connected with the stone-grasping module 41, the other end of the positioning component 42 is movably connected with the installation base 1, the jewelry stone-grasping processing device has a simple structure and a reasonable design, when the jewelry stone-grasping processing device is used, the moving distance of the stone-grasping module 41 can be adjusted by adjusting the limiting component 42, so that the force applied to jewelry fixing can be controlled, and the positioning component 3 can ensure that the stone-grasping module 41 is accurately pressed to the jewelry fixing jig, therefore, efficient and accurate jewelry press-grabbing stone processing is carried out, damage to jewelry is avoided, and the yield of products is effectively improved.
The mounting base 1 comprises a bottom plate 11, a supporting column 12, a fixing plate 13 and a connecting column 14, the supporting column 12 and the connecting column 14 are respectively connected with the bottom plate 11, the fixing plate 13 is fixedly connected with the top end of the supporting column 12, the jewelry fixing jig 2 is arranged on the fixing plate 13, the pressing and grabbing stone component 4 is arranged on the connecting column 14, the structure of the mounting base 1 in the embodiment is simple and reasonable in arrangement, and the jewelry fixing jig 2 and the pressing and grabbing stone component 4 are convenient to install and fix.
The positioning assembly 3 is provided with a guide pillar 31 and a positioning plate 32 which are connected with each other, the mounting base 1 is provided with a guide hole 15 for the guide pillar 31 to extend into and out of, the positioning plate 32 is connected with the pressed stone grasping module 41, and the pressed stone grasping module 41 drives the guide pillar 31 to extend into or out of the guide hole 15 when moving vertically.

The adjustment limiting member 42 comprises an adjustment spring 421, a limiting bolt 422 and a spring fixing rod 423, the top end of the stone pressing and grabbing module 41 is provided with a fixing ring 412 and a screw hole, the bottom end of the spring fixing rod 423 is fixedly connected with the gear box 43, both ends of the adjusting spring 421 are respectively connected to the fixing ring 412 and the spring fixing rod 423, the limit bolt 422 is arranged in the threaded hole, the stone pressing and grabbing module 41 can drive the limit bolt 422 to move vertically, and the limit bolt 422 abuts against the gear box 43 to limit the moving distance of the pressing and grabbing stone module 41, in this embodiment, by adjusting the distance between the screw head of the limit bolt 422 and the gear box 43, thereby the distance of stone module 41 downstream is grabbed in the control pressure, avoids the displacement too big, leads to the clamping ring jack catch or crush the jewelry, realizes accurate pressure and grabs stone processing.
